Providence Cancer Institute brings together the leading cancer specialists, clinical and research teams of Providence, including the Earle A. Chiles Research Institute in the Robert W. Franz Cancer Center on the campus of Providence Portland Medical Center, as well as top-rated Oncology clinics in hospitals across the Oregon region. Multidisciplinary, tumor-site-specific teams work together to give patients and their families the best care possible and access to the most promising clinical trials and advanced technology.

Portland is rich in character and culture, with strong neighborhood identities and community bonds that defy its population of 2.3 million. Home of the Portland Trail Blazers, "Rip City" is ranked No. 8 in the Best Places to Live by U.S. News & World Report, based on its high quality of life and thriving job market. A foodie mecca, Portland is ideally situated between waterfalls, beaches, Mt. Hood skiing and hiking trails, forests and the Columbia River Gorge.
